Transaction dedf10660be2e185c356643b62b39ac6a47f642f0341996057dc4b7e60fa63bd
1 Input
1 Output
-
dedf10660be2e185c356643b62b39ac6a47f642f0341996057dc4b7e60fa63bd:0
- value
- 60699
- script pubkey
- OP_0 OP_PUSHBYTES_20 4aa84e7d60baac3b975874f5283ad9a87417294c
- address
- bc1qf25yultqh2krh96cwn6jswke4p6pw22v6tzec8